WHEN youngsters returned to the nursery at Murrayfield school at the end of the summer holidays this month, they found their three-foot sunflower had grown into this 10-foot plus monster!

The triffid-like plant grew like topsy during August - despite having no care or attention during the holiday.

Nursery nurse Anne Berry said: “It's not even one we planted. It's a self-sown sunflower from last year - the ones we planted look weedy by comparison!

“The children watered and cared for it last term, but nothing happened during the holidays and it's shot up - we're all astonished by it,” she added.
